Quatre Saisons Blanc Mousseux
Selling Name (UK): Quatre Saisons Blanc Mousseux
Varietal Name:
Description
- Type : Old Historic roses
- Flower Colour: white
- Fragrance: 6 to 8 Very Strong
- Flowering Period: repeat
- Foliage: Medium green
- Use: Borders, Mixed Planting
- Special Instructions: Moss rose which repeats sparingly in the autumn
- Planting Distance (cm Approximately): 100cm
- Bred By: Laffay
- Year of UK Introduction: prior 1837
- Parentage: Quatre Saisons sport
